Agents launch marks expansion of Droitwich logistics park

Potter Space, a leader in the sub-100k sq. ft. industrial and logistics property sector, has welcomed commercial property agents to the launch of the first phase of their proposed £18M expansion at their Droitwich site in order to meet growing demand in the market.

This first phase of the development comprises of four units. These range in size from 22,000 – 30,500 sq. ft. occupying a total of 105,000 sq. ft., and will bring the footprint of the Droitwich site to 400,000 sq. ft.

Sustainability has been built into the new units, with each on track to receive a BREEAM ‘very good’ rating. Solar panels, LED lighting and other sustainability measures have also been factored into the builds by Potter Space. Businesses already calling the location home include Akzo Nobel, Volker Laser and Bowker Group.  

The initial phase of the development is part of a long-term plan to double the size of the Droitwich business park which has easy access to Birmingham, Nottingham and Worcestershire, as well as the M40, M5 and M6 motorways. Potter Space Droitwich is an ideal strategic location for businesses looking for industrial and logistics space in the West Midlands region.

Jason Rockett, managing director at Potter Space, said: “Extensive research has shown there is a lack of supply in the Droitwich area that has led to pent up demand for space, which is why we are investing in this location. Our site is currently fully let, with our existing customers keen to expand their presence and new customers looking to relocate to Potter Space Droitwich.

“The agent launch event was a great opportunity to show agents around the first of our two new units which have already attracted the attention of potential customers. They were able to see first-hand the excellent standards that our construction team are working to throughout this project.”

The first two units currently under construction are due for completion in Spring 2023.
